    We live near Casa Della Nonna, passing it daily, but honestly never had the desire to check them out, since we so love our normal go-to Italian spot, also nearby, Mamma Roma's- but when dining w.friends they wanted to pick up pizza from their go-to spot, and we found ourselves having the opportunity to check out Casa Della Nonna. Their menu offerd pretty much the same dishes at equal prices. We decided to order our favorite go-to dishes to really compare the two locations. Ordering spaghetti puttanesca w.added sausage ($3) & a meat calzone w.added green peppers & onions (they didn't charge to add these) The puttanesca was very different than I expected, but I know the dish can be made in a variety of ways based on the regional culture. I'm used to black olives, chunks of fresh tomatoes, charred garlic, loaded w.sauce and capers w.ground sausage- Casa Della Nonna used kalamata olives, no tomatoes, ample sauce, but very minimal capers, and wilted spinach w.sliced Italian sausage. I prefer my original, as I felt the kalamata olives created a twangy vinegary taste, taking away from the anchovy paste that should stand out as front runner, and I was sad about the lack of capers adding a pop. Though I was impressed by the large amount of added on sausage- that had very bold spicy flavors, moist and hearty. The meat calzone comes w. mozzarella & ricotta cheese blended w. pepperoni, ham, and sausage- we requested to add green peppers & onions, which come in our go-to's calzone- the calzone was a very big letdown- a large looking calzone- barely filled on the inside & absolutely NO seasoning. The ingredients were all arranged in a pile in the middle, creating a lot of dough only bites around the edges & sides. We actually had to cut open the entire thing & rearrange, add seasonings, and smother in sauce- the pepperoni wasn't cooked, so it had the raw charcuterie taste instead of a nice melted crispy char-and maybe I got all the sausage left in my pasta, because I found myself adding sausage from my pasta to the calzone to avoid just dough bites. The pizza our friend ordered looked like heated oven Costco pizza, no 'tip sag' not that cheesy and undercooked looking dough Overall, the food was less impressive in quality and flavor profile- we thought maybe we'll give them another chance, trying other dishes, but realized why? when we know a really great reliable place just as close.
